Abstract: Disclosed is a process to produce a hypophosphite salt defined as [C+ hypophosphite−] by reacting P4 with a hydroxide salt defined as [C+OH−], or a hydroxide salt precursor and a catalyst, wherein C+ is the cationic moiety of [C+ hypophosphite−] salt.
